Benefits of Automatic Hen Feeders

Enhanced Productivity:
- Regular and precise feed delivery ensures optimal intake, leading to increased egg production by up to 15%.
- Eliminates feed wastage, reducing costs and promoting feed efficiency.

Improved Health:
- Consistent feeding reduces stress and aggression among hens, fostering a healthier flock.
- Preset feeding times ensure timely access to feed, preventing hunger-related ailments and mortality.

Time and Labor Savings:
- Automated feeding eliminates manual labor, freeing up farmers for other essential tasks.
- Programmable timers allow for flexible feeding schedules, accommodating different flock sizes and routines.

Types of Automatic Hen Feeders

Chain Feeders:
- A motorized chain transports feed along a track, distributing it to multiple feeding points.
- Ideal for large-scale operations with considerable flock sizes.

Trough Feeders:
- Feed is dispensed into a trough, enabling hens to access it simultaneously.
- Suitable for smaller flocks or free-range environments.

Tube Feeders:
- Feed is delivered through tubes to individual feeding stations.
- Provides precise feed control and reduces cross-contamination.

Considerations for Selecting an Automatic Hen Feeder

  • Flock Size: Determine the appropriate feeder size and capacity based on the number of hens.
  • Feed Type: Consider the feeder's compatibility with the specific feed type used (pellets, mash, or grains).
  • Housing Type: Select a feeder suitable for the poultry house's design and ventilation system.
  • Power Source: Ensure the availability of reliable power or consider solar-powered feeders for remote or off-grid locations.

Best Practices for Using Automatic Hen Feeders

  • Proper Installation: Follow manufacturer's instructions for correct installation and calibration.
  • Regular Maintenance: Inspect and clean the feeder regularly to ensure smooth operation and prevent blockages.
  • Set Optimal Feeding Schedule: Determine the ideal feeding times and quantities based on the flock's age, breed, and production goals.
  • Monitor Feed Consumption: Observe feed levels and adjust feeding intervals or quantities as needed to prevent over- or underfeeding.
  • Use High-Quality Feed: Ensure the feed is nutritious, palatable, and free from contaminants to promote hen health and productivity.

Tips and Tricks

  • Consider a backup system: Install a generator or battery backup in case of power outages to prevent feed interruptions.
  • Provide extra feed points: Multiple feeding stations can reduce competition and improve feed intake.
  • Adjust feed height: Ensure the feed is accessible to all hens, regardless of their size.
  • Avoid overfilling: Keep the feed level below the rim of the feeder to prevent feed spillage and contamination.
  • Monitor hens' behavior: Observe hens' feeding patterns to identify any signs of health issues or feed-related problems.

Common Mistakes to Avoid

  • Using unsuitable feeders for the flock size: Overcrowding or underfeeding can lead to productivity issues and health concerns.
  • Neglecting maintenance: Unclean or malfunctioning feeders can compromise feed quality and promote disease transmission.
  • Overfeeding: Excessive feed intake can result in obesity, metabolic disorders, and reduced egg production.
  • Ignoring feed quality: Supplying hens with nutrient-poor feed can undermine their health and productivity.
  • Insufficient feed supply: Running out of feed can cause stress, hunger, and health problems in flocks.

FAQs

  1. Can automatic hen feeders be used for different breeds of hens?
    Yes, automatic hen feeders are compatible with most chicken breeds, but it's crucial to select a feeder that accommodates the specific size and feed requirements of the flock.

  2. How often should I clean my automatic hen feeder?
    Regular cleaning is essential to prevent blockages and maintain feed hygiene. Inspect and clean the feeder at least once a week, or more frequently if needed.

  3. What happens if the power goes out?
    Consider installing a generator or battery backup to ensure uninterrupted feeding during power outages. Some solar-powered feeders are also available for off-grid operations.

  4. How do I adjust the feeding schedule on my automatic hen feeder?
    Most automatic hen feeders feature programmable timers that allow for flexible feeding schedules. Refer to the manufacturer's instructions for specific programming steps.

  5. What is the average lifespan of an automatic hen feeder?
    The lifespan of an automatic hen feeder depends on its quality and maintenance. With proper care and maintenance, a high-quality feeder can last for several years.

  6. Can automatic hen feeders help prevent rodents from accessing feed?
    Yes, automatic hen feeders can be designed with rodent-proof features, such as sealed feed containers or baffles that prevent rodents from reaching the feed.

  7. Are there any safety precautions I need to take when using automatic hen feeders?
    Ensure the feeder is installed and operated according to the manufacturer's instructions. Keep the feeder away from water sources and avoid overloading it to prevent spillage and potential hazards.

  8. How can I troubleshoot common problems with automatic hen feeders?
    Troubleshooting steps may vary depending on the feeder model. Refer to the manufacturer's manual for specific guidance on resolving issues such as feed blockages, irregular feeding schedules, or power supply problems.
